CVE-2024-53984Network attack vector

Memory exhaustion via unreleased delimited-message allocations

Published Dec 2, 2024 · Updated Dec 2, 2024

Memory leak in Nanopb 0.4.0 through 0.4.9 allows remote authenticated users to interrupt services via malformed delimited messages. In pb_decode_ex(), a failed pb_close_string_substream() returned before the PB_ENABLE_MALLOC cleanup path, so pb_release() never freed FT_POINTER allocations. The path requires malloc support, an FT_POINTER field, an unknown-length custom stream, PB_DECODE_DELIMITED, and a corrupted length prefix; repeated failures can exhaust memory.
